#3dc9c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dc9cd is composed of 23.9% red, 78.8%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.2% cyan, 2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 181.7 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 52.2%. #3dc9cd color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#00939b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#3dc9c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dc9cd has RGB values of R:61, G:201,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4049357.

Shades and Tints of #3dc9c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fd is the lightest one.
